    We have recently ventured into the forex market. At the start of last year we began mangeing some client money through several different forex sources. We were very disappointed in the spread and execution of trades through most front ends. the thing about forex markets is that there is no central market place, like an exchange. So the deal with most of the FX trading sites is that they are trading off of the positions that the small independent traders are executiong. Now you can get tighter spreads that are not offset if you pay a commision per trade.
